Revving up the Automotive Ecosystem

Also at CES, we announced 4 new automotive partnerships with Aisin AW (navigation), HERE (navigation), HI Corporation (HMI tools), and Qualcomm (processors). Better yet, more than 12 partners joined us to showcase the latest apps, SoCs, nav engines, speech interfaces, and music services for the car. Read the press release.

From Safety Systems to Smartphone Integration

In February, QNX experts will speak at Embedded World 2014 in Nuremburg, at the Safety-critical Systems Symposium in Brighton, and at Smartphone Vehicle Integration and Connectivity 2014 in San Francisco. QNX Software Systems will also exhibit at Embedded World.
